The Role of the Situation Model in Mathematical Modelling—Task Analyses, Student Competencies, and Teacher Interventions
Dominik Leiss,Stanislaw Schukajlow,Werner Blum,Rudolf Messner,Reinhard Pekrun +4 more
- 05 Feb 2010
TL;DR: This article investigated the role that the construction of situation models plays as an essential prerequisite for understanding a given mathematical modelling task, using a sample of 21 9th grade classes (N=416).

Reconceptualising Word Problems as Exercises in Mathematical Modelling
Lieven Verschaffel,Wim Van Dooren,Brian Greer,Swapna Mukhopadhyay +3 more
- 05 Feb 2010
TL;DR: A review and discussion of research on the phenomenon of “suspension of sense-making” when doing school arithmetic word problems, including a summary of earlier work culminating in the book by Verschaffel et al. (2000) and with special attention to the more recent empirical work.
